I have a healthy 3" quarantined (for 3+ months) Purple Tang. This individual eats Nori, PE-Pellets, Mysis shrimp, Spirulina Brine Shrimp.
Well fed and active. Fish is located in Wildwood Florida, 32163 (The Villages).

Local pickup would be best - Valued at ~$150
Don't need equipment but open to Corals - Would love a Torch or other interesting items

Quarantined was mentioned as in the past tense. Meaning it was quarantined and is disease free.
I follow a strict quarantine (QT) protocol to be as sure as possible that I eradicate disease.
Others follow a manage it philosophy, meaning that they treat for it, if and when it occurs.
